🔹 Focus on the Details 🔹

In this video, instructor Roldani Baldwin works with one of our guys on the importance of staying inside the ball—but not just staying inside, doing it with strength. ⚡ Many hitters tend to get around the ball, losing power and consistency in their swing. Here, we correct that and focus on the right movement to maximize solid contact. 💪⚾

Quick hands. Quiet body. 🔥⚾️

We work on proper hand technique by keeping the upper body still and letting the hands do the work. Staying tight to your body and using smooth, controlled movements helps create better barrel control, cleaner mechanics, and more consistency through the zone.

Small details create big results.

A lot of young pitchers throw with all deltoid and no connection. That’s where velocity leaks, inconsistency starts, and arm issues can happen.

Today we worked on proper arm positioning, rotation mechanics, and learning how to engage the pec during the throw to create a cleaner, more powerful movement pattern. Fastball first mentality. Then we carried that same intent into the changeup — throwing it through the top of the catcher’s mask without slowing the body down.

Same arm speed. Same aggression. Different result.
